Coventry to Birmingham train tickets: everything you need to know

Coventry station is situated on the Southern edge of the city centre and provides 103 regular trains per day to Birmingham New Street from Platforms 3 and 4. The station is served by Avanti West Coast, London Northwestern, West Midlands Railway, and CrossCountry.

Both Avanti West Coast and CrossCountry provide similar routes and train duration, with one stop at Birmingham International and a typical journey time of 21 minutes. West Midlands Trains, on the other hand, takes around 29 minutes with five stops, allowing you to disembark at Canley, Tile Hill, Berkswell, Hampton-in-Arden, and Birmingham International.

The average cost of train tickets from Coventry to Birmingham New Street is £5.90. To save on your journey, consider booking in advance or purchasing a Railcard, which can save you up to 1/3 on eligible journeys for a whole year.

You'll arrive at Birmingham New Street, the largest and busiest of the three main railway stations in Birmingham city centre, England. It's served by Avanti West Coast, CrossCountry, West Midlands Railway, London Northwestern Railway, and Transport for Wales. The station also offers excellent connectivity to various destinations, including Preston, Edinburgh, Glasgow, Manchester, and Bristol. Additionally, it connects to the West Midlands Metro tram system via West Midlands Metro Line One.

Are trains running between Birmingham and Coventry?

Yes, trains operate regularly between Birmingham and Coventry. Both West Midlands Railway and Avanti West Coast provide frequent services throughout the day, with journey times typically between 20 to 30 minutes.

Can you get a direct train from Coventry?

Yes, you can take a direct train from Birmingham to Coventry. Trains run frequently throughout the day, with services operated by West Midlands Railway and Avanti West Coast. The journey typically takes around 20 to 30 minutes.
